About Ran Deng
Ran Deng is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Materials Chemistry, Water Science and Technology, Surfaces, Coatings and Films and Molecular Biology, having authored 35 papers that have together received 605 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Solar-Powered Water Purification Methods (7 papers), Membrane Separation Technologies (7 papers), Surface Modification and Superhydrophobicity (5 papers),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(4 papers), MXene and MAX Phase Materials (4 papers), Solar Thermal and Photovoltaic Systems (3 papers), Polymer Surface Interaction Studies (3 papers) and Ammonia Synthesis and Nitrogen Reduction (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Surfaces, Coatings and Films (188 citations), Water Science and Technology (98 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(101 citations), Cancer Research (84 citations) and Transplantation (9 citations). Ran Deng has collaborated with scholars based in China, Hong Kong and Singapore. Frequent co-authors include Hao‐Cheng Yang, Weihua Li, Honglei Chen, Ting Shen, Jiaxing Lu, Zhi‐Kang Xu, Jun Xu, Ling‐Shu Wan, King Lun Yeung and Wei Han. Their work appears in journals such as 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ces, Journal of Colloid and Interface Science, Journal of Materials Chemistry A, Frontiers in Immunology and Catalysis Today.
